edu.usc.cse.desi.editor
Class PaletteFactory

java.lang.Object
  extended byedu.usc.cse.desi.editor.PaletteFactory

public class PaletteFactory
extends java.lang.Object

Author:
Nels Started Mar 7, 2004

Constructor Summary
PaletteFactory()
           
 
Method Summary
private static java.util.List createCategories(org.eclipse.gef.palette.PaletteRoot root)
           
private static org.eclipse.gef.palette.PaletteContainer createComponentsDrawer()
           
private static org.eclipse.gef.palette.PaletteContainer createControlGroup(org.eclipse.gef.palette.PaletteRoot root)
           
static org.eclipse.gef.palette.PaletteRoot createPalette()
          Creates the PaletteRoot and adds all Palette elements.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PaletteFactory

public PaletteFactory()
Method Detail

createCategories

private static java.util.List createCategories(org.eclipse.gef.palette.PaletteRoot root)

createControlGroup

private static org.eclipse.gef.palette.PaletteContainer createControlGroup(org.eclipse.gef.palette.PaletteRoot root)

createComponentsDrawer

private static org.eclipse.gef.palette.PaletteContainer createComponentsDrawer()

createPalette

public static org.eclipse.gef.palette.PaletteRoot createPalette()
Creates the PaletteRoot and adds all Palette elements.

Returns:
the root